| #include "object_properties.h"
 | |
| #include "irrlichttypes_bloated.h"
 | |
| #include "exceptions.h"
 | |
| #include "util/serialize.h"
 | |
| #include "util/basic_macros.h"
 | |
| #include <sstream>
 | |
| 
 | |
| ObjectProperties::ObjectProperties()
 | |
| {
 | |
| 	textures.emplace_back("unknown_object.png");
 | |
| 	colors.emplace_back(255,255,255,255);
 | |
| }
 | |
| 
 | |
| std::string ObjectProperties::dump()
 | |
| {
 | |
| 	std::ostringstream os(std::ios::binary);
 | |
| 	os<<"hp_max="<<hp_max;
 | |
| 	os<<", physical="<<physical;
 | |
| 	os<<", collideWithObjects="<<collideWithObjects;
 | |
| 	os<<", weight="<<weight;
 | |
| 	os<<", collisionbox="<<PP(collisionbox.MinEdge)<<","<<PP(collisionbox.MaxEdge);
 | |
| 	os<<", visual="<<visual;
 | |
| 	os<<", mesh="<<mesh;
 | |
| 	os<<", visual_size="<<PP2(visual_size);
 | |
| 	os<<", textures=[";
 | |
| 	for (const std::string &texture : textures) {
 | |
| 		os<<"\""<< texture <<"\" ";
 | |
| 	}
 | |
| 	os<<"]";
 | |
| 	os<<", colors=[";
 | |
| 	for (const video::SColor &color : colors) {
 | |
| 		os << "\"" << color.getAlpha() << "," << color.getRed() << ","
 | |
| 			<< color.getGreen() << "," << color.getBlue() << "\" ";
 | |
| 	}
 | |
| 	os<<"]";
 | |
| 	os<<", spritediv="<<PP2(spritediv);
 | |
| 	os<<", initial_sprite_basepos="<<PP2(initial_sprite_basepos);
 | |
| 	os<<", is_visible="<<is_visible;
 | |
| 	os<<", makes_footstep_sound="<<makes_footstep_sound;
 | |
| 	os<<", automatic_rotate="<<automatic_rotate;
 | |
| 	os<<", backface_culling="<<backface_culling;
 | |
| 	os << ", nametag=" << nametag;
 | |
| 	os << ", nametag_color=" << "\"" << nametag_color.getAlpha() << "," << nametag_color.getRed()
 | |
| 			<< "," << nametag_color.getGreen() << "," << nametag_color.getBlue() << "\" ";
 | |
| 	return os.str();
 | |
| }
 | |
| 
 | |
| void ObjectProperties::serialize(std::ostream &os) const
 | |
| {
 | |
| 	writeU8(os, 1); // version
 | |
| 	writeS16(os, hp_max);
 | |
| 	writeU8(os, physical);
 | |
| 	writeF1000(os, weight);
 | |
| 	writeV3F1000(os, collisionbox.MinEdge);
 | |
| 	writeV3F1000(os, collisionbox.MaxEdge);
 | |
| 	os<<serializeString(visual);
 | |
| 	writeV2F1000(os, visual_size);
 | |
| 	writeU16(os, textures.size());
 | |
| 	for (const std::string &texture : textures) {
 | |
| 		os << serializeString(texture);
 | |
| 	}
 | |
| 	writeV2S16(os, spritediv);
 | |
| 	writeV2S16(os, initial_sprite_basepos);
 | |
| 	writeU8(os, is_visible);
 | |
| 	writeU8(os, makes_footstep_sound);
 | |
| 	writeF1000(os, automatic_rotate);
 | |
| 	// Added in protocol version 14
 | |
| 	os<<serializeString(mesh);
 | |
| 	writeU16(os, colors.size());
 | |
| 	for (video::SColor color : colors) {
 | |
| 		writeARGB8(os, color);
 | |
| 	}
 | |
| 	writeU8(os, collideWithObjects);
 | |
| 	writeF1000(os,stepheight);
 | |
| 	writeU8(os, automatic_face_movement_dir);
 | |
| 	writeF1000(os, automatic_face_movement_dir_offset);
 | |
| 	writeU8(os, backface_culling);
 | |
| 	os << serializeString(nametag);
 | |
| 	writeARGB8(os, nametag_color);
 | |
| 	writeF1000(os, automatic_face_movement_max_rotation_per_sec);
 | |
| 	os << serializeString(infotext);
 | |
| 	os << serializeString(wield_item);
 | |
| 
 | |
| 	// Add stuff only at the bottom.
 | |
| 	// Never remove anything, because we don't want new versions of this
 | |
| }
 | |
| 
 | |
| void ObjectProperties::deSerialize(std::istream &is)
 | |
| {
 | |
| 	int version = readU8(is);
 | |
| 	if(version == 1)
 | |
| 	{
 | |
| 		try{
 | |
| 			hp_max = readS16(is);
 | |
| 			physical = readU8(is);
 | |
| 			weight = readF1000(is);
 | |
| 			collisionbox.MinEdge = readV3F1000(is);
 | |
| 			collisionbox.MaxEdge = readV3F1000(is);
 | |
| 			visual = deSerializeString(is);
 | |
| 			visual_size = readV2F1000(is);
 | |
| 			textures.clear();
 | |
| 			u32 texture_count = readU16(is);
 | |
| 			for(u32 i=0; i<texture_count; i++){
 | |
| 				textures.push_back(deSerializeString(is));
 | |
| 			}
 | |
| 			spritediv = readV2S16(is);
 | |
| 			initial_sprite_basepos = readV2S16(is);
 | |
| 			is_visible = readU8(is);
 | |
| 			makes_footstep_sound = readU8(is);
 | |
| 			automatic_rotate = readF1000(is);
 | |
| 			mesh = deSerializeString(is);
 | |
| 			u32 color_count = readU16(is);
 | |
| 			for(u32 i=0; i<color_count; i++){
 | |
| 				colors.push_back(readARGB8(is));
 | |
| 			}
 | |
| 			collideWithObjects = readU8(is);
 | |
| 			stepheight = readF1000(is);
 | |
| 			automatic_face_movement_dir = readU8(is);
 | |
| 			automatic_face_movement_dir_offset = readF1000(is);
 | |
| 			backface_culling = readU8(is);
 | |
| 			nametag = deSerializeString(is);
 | |
| 			nametag_color = readARGB8(is);
 | |
| 			automatic_face_movement_max_rotation_per_sec = readF1000(is);
 | |
| 			infotext = deSerializeString(is);
 | |
| 			wield_item = deSerializeString(is);
 | |
| 		}catch(SerializationError &e){}
 | |
| 	}
 | |
| 	else
 | |
| 	{
 | |
| 		throw SerializationError("unsupported ObjectProperties version");
 | |
| 	}
 | |
| }
